Video: First look at how new Pokémon app Pikachu Talk works on Amazon Alexa and Google Home

Nintendo Co., Ltd. recently applied for a trademark for Pikachu Talk, which is the upcoming Pokémon app for Google Home, Google Home Mini and Amazon Alexa devices. Pikachu Talk allows users of either device to communicate with Pokémon’s chief mascot – Pikachu. The app is scheduled to be released by the end of this year in Japan, followed by a worldwide launch in 2018 and beyond.
